The Fisheries industry probably is one of the fastest food-producing sectors in Oman, valued at around RO 104 million and contributing around 0.5 per cent of the nation’s GDP. Despite being seen as one of the most promising sectors, there is a need to address vital issues related to the sector such as; supply, shortage of skilled fishermen, comprehensible regulatory framework and policies and development of modern facilities. This, in fact, would support the sector improve quality and production and other related concerns, which hinder the sector’s growth.
